Transaction 2172570d72e81d084122b5eace3ff1808021b695f23397d3b185491ee1a4c237
2 Input
2 Outputs
- 2172570d72e81d084122b5eace3ff1808021b695f23397d3b185491ee1a4c237:0
- 2172570d72e81d084122b5eace3ff1808021b695f23397d3b185491ee1a4c237:1
value 25993
address 17ZjBaEHisfYenFBGG7A8T978Eib98WsHt
value 176704
address 3BrqPxWGojMunMyM8t97jTU9JZqtTjP32g